Topic overview

Plants can be infected by a range of pathogens and are also damaged by ion deficiencies. This is a Triple-only topic.

Plant diseases can be detected by stunted growth, spots on leaves, patches of decay, abnormal growths, malformed stems or leaves, and discolouration. Identification methods include using a gardening manual, taking the plant to a laboratory to identify the pathogen, or using testing kits containing monoclonal antibodies.

Deficiencies produce their own symptoms. Stunted growth indicates a nitrate deficiency, because nitrates are needed for protein synthesis and therefore growth. Chlorosis — yellow leaves — indicates a magnesium deficiency, because magnesium is needed to make chlorophyll.

Revision notes

Detecting plant disease

Signs include stunted growth, spots on leaves, areas of decay, growths, malformed stems or leaves, and discolouration.

Identification: a gardening manual or website, laboratory identification of the pathogen, or testing kits containing monoclonal antibodies.

Ion deficiencies

Stunted growth is caused by nitrate deficiency, because nitrate ions are needed for protein synthesis and therefore for growth.

Chlorosis, meaning yellow leaves, is caused by magnesium deficiency, because magnesium is needed to make chlorophyll for photosynthesis.

Plant defence responses

Physical: a waxy cuticle, cell walls, and layers of dead cells such as bark that fall off.

Chemical: antibacterial chemicals and poisons that deter herbivores. Mechanical: thorns and hairs, leaves that droop or curl on touch, and mimicry to trick animals.

Worked examples

Example 1

A plant has yellow leaves. Name the ion likely to be deficient and explain why this causes yellowing. [3 marks]

Model answer

Magnesium (1 mark). Magnesium ions are needed to make chlorophyll (1 mark), so without enough magnesium the plant cannot produce sufficient chlorophyll and the leaves appear yellow rather than green (1 mark).

Example 2

Explain why a nitrate deficiency causes stunted growth. [2 marks]

Model answer

Nitrate ions are needed for protein synthesis (1 mark), and proteins are required for growth, so without enough nitrate the plant cannot grow properly (1 mark).

Example 3

Describe two mechanical defences plants use against herbivores. [2 marks]

Model answer

Thorns or hairs which deter animals from eating the plant (1 mark), and leaves that droop or curl when touched, or mimicry to trick animals into not eating them (1 mark).

Common mistakes

  • Confusing nitrate and magnesium deficiency symptoms.

    Nitrate deficiency stunts growth; magnesium deficiency causes yellow leaves.

  • Not explaining why the symptom occurs.

    Link magnesium to chlorophyll and nitrate to protein synthesis.

  • Calling chlorosis a disease.

    It is a deficiency symptom, not an infection.

  • Mixing up the three defence types.

    Physical are barriers, chemical are substances, mechanical involve movement or structures like thorns.

Key terms

Chlorosis
Yellowing of leaves caused by lack of chlorophyll.
Nitrate ion
An ion needed by plants for protein synthesis.
Magnesium ion
An ion needed by plants to make chlorophyll.
Mimicry
A defence in which a plant resembles something else to deter animals.
